You guys get to buy your used cars cheaply. $6000 here in Australia will only get you into an early 190E, and probably only a 2 litre at that. The 2.3 is rare here so they sell at similar money to the 2.6 at around $9k upwards. A late (update) 2.6 or Sportline is usually around $12k or more here. Even our basic 180E (190E-1.8) which are all '91 or newer still sell at around $8k-11k. The damaged (big hit in rear) 2.6 manual I posted the link to in my earlier post sold at auction yesterday for $1250. Admittedly our dollar is only around US$0.78, but it gives an intersting comparison.
